I am ready to paint my home made Mobil horse and I have a question. I have looked at photos of several signs and I notice that some have a white outside edge border and some have a blue border. Is one "more" correct than the other? Thanks.

I have an original Mobil Pegasus horse "cookie cutter" design type sign and it has a white outside edge.

Thanks, The cookie cutter style signs that I have seen also have the white border but I have also seen flat signs that use the dark border. It will be mounted on a light colored bldg and I am thinking the dark edge may look better. Anybody else have an opinion?
